The Parcelwing webhook handler is built from the sealed `delivery-hooks` repo only. Builds run on isolated runners; no network egress during compile. Each artifact carries a signed attestation binding source commit, builder identity, and dependency lockfile digest. Reviewers must confirm the attestation chain before approving deploys — unsigned artifacts are rejected at admission. Third-party carrier SDKs are vendored and hash-pinned; drift fails the build. The currently deployed artifact's provenance token is recorded below.

pipeline stamp: htk6_35e0c9

## Changelog — Font vendoring defaults changed

As of this release, the Bracken UI build no longer fetches third-party fonts at build time. All typefaces used by the Lanternwell suite are now vendored into the repo under a dedicated assets directory, and the fetch step is skipped by default. If you're onboarding, nothing to install — the fonts travel with the checkout. The build flags controlling this behavior are listed below.

settings of hadup-yafog:
LAMAEL_PIN=3761
LAMAEL_TENANT=istmir
LAMAEL_METRICS_HOST=metrics.lamael.plorvasys.test
LAMAEL_SEAL=seal_8ea68500
LAMAEL_STANDBY_TEAM=fraok

Welcome to the Bouncer rotation! Bouncer is Marlowe Systems' email bounce processor — it eats delivery failure notifications, classifies them (hard vs soft), and flips suppression flags in the mail ledger. Most pages are just the classifier choking on a weird provider format; requeue and move on. Hard bounces that look wrong should go to the deliverability channel, not get auto-cleared. The full triage flowchart lives on our internal wiki page.

wiki page, hahif-hahif: https://argocd.kelvisys.corp/browse/board/settings/pages/1442e0b1065d83f1

## Formula sandbox tuning

User-supplied formulas in Gridmoor execute inside a restricted interpreter with hard ceilings on time, memory, and call depth. Reviewers should confirm any change to these ceilings is justified in the PR description, since raising them widens the abuse surface. Defaults were chosen from production traces. The current limits are as follows.

limits module of tafog-fawip:
WEIGHTS = {
    "julix": 57,
    "lamys": 992,
    "kasvan": 209,
    "quenok": 750,
    "alddor": 259,
    "oliath": 1009,
    "wenix": 815,
}